CALGARY – Sixteen beef breeds were represented at this year’s Calgary Stampede. The Piedmontese is the newest group to parade through the showring.

In the supreme beef champion show, the winner in the bull class was a Charolais named Sharphills Maximizer 102B from Target Cattle Company, of Calgary and Sharp Hills Charolais, of Sedalia, Alta. The supreme champion female was a Limousin named Highland Ballerina CMA 61B from Highland Stock Farms, of Calgary.
